The “Take It Down Act” represents a major federal step in addressing the misuse of AI technology. Passed in the House with a 409–2 vote, it criminalizes the creation and distribution of nonconsensual AI-generated sexual content, including deepfake pornography that has increasingly affected students, professionals, and minors.
